The evening opens at 6 pm with Kamica King, a Dallas-based singer-songwriter with a radiant stage presence and folk/soul sound informed by jazz and her Afro-Caribbean roots. A United States Cultural Ambassador & Texas Touring Roster artist with global reach, Kamica authentically connects to the heart of her listeners. Kamika has been featured by the Kennedy Center, US Open (USTA), TEDx, and abroad, performing in Africa, Trinidad, and Colombia. Kamica has also caught the attention of NPR Tiny Desk Concert creator Bob Boilen, who interviewed her after hearing her song "Live, Love, Dream.”

Then, headlining performers extraordinaire The Peterson Brothers return with their very own blend of Americana music consisting of classic Soul, Funk, Blues, and Jazz. Hailing from the vibrant musical hub of Austin, Texas, the dynamic duo consists of Glenn Jr. on vocals and guitar, and Alex, a GRAMMY® award-winning artist, on bass, vocals, and violin. As torchbearers of classic American music inspired by their family matriarchs, The Peterson Brothers captivate audiences with their infectious spirit and musical talent that pays homage to the timeless sounds that started their journey.
